How does Lockland, OH compare to Northfield, OH? Lockland has a population of 3,493 with a median household income of $49,174, while Northfield has 3,525 residents and a median income of $69,444.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Lockland, OH | Northfield,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 3,493 | 3,525 | -0.9% |
| Median Age | 44.4 | 42.9 | +3.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 2.2% | 11% | -80.0% |
| Metric | Lockland | Northfield |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$49,174 | $69,444 | -29.2% |
| Unemployment | 12.5% | 4% | +212.5% |
| Poverty Rate | 18.4% | 11.5% | +60.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 13.5% | 24.2% | -44.2% |
| Metric | Lockland | Northfield |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$101,200 | $168,300 | -39.9% |
| Median Rent | $710/mo | $855/mo | -17.0% |
| Housing Units | 1,658 | 1,568 | +5.7% |
